Commit graph

716 commits

Author SHA1 Message Date
Mouse Reeve 827badac7c
Merge pull request #216 from mouse-reeve/change-password
Change password for logged in users
2020-10-02 15:50:48 -07:00
Mouse Reeve 01aa0a86d6
Merge pull request #217 from mouse-reeve/unique-emails
Make user email addresses unique
2020-10-02 15:50:31 -07:00
Mouse Reeve f242ca0168
Merge pull request #219 from mouse-reeve/admin
Basic Django admin
2020-10-02 15:42:23 -07:00
Mouse Reeve fa992091d5 Updates license version 2020-10-02 15:41:04 -07:00
Mouse Reeve c41a762442
Merge pull request #218 from mouse-reeve/null-states
Basic null states (still needs expanding)
2020-10-02 15:38:54 -07:00
Mouse Reeve 1f8ac546fa Adds site settings and users to django admin 2020-10-02 15:34:03 -07:00
Mouse Reeve 9627be3fa7 Basic null states (still needs expanding) 2020-10-02 15:06:42 -07:00
Mouse Reeve c8348606da Fixes login flow 2020-10-02 15:01:22 -07:00
Mouse Reeve 8433d8bf41 Make user email addresses unique 2020-10-02 14:56:37 -07:00
Mouse Reeve b331978964 email sender 2020-10-02 14:55:28 -07:00
Mouse Reeve 2b681286f4 Change password for logged in users 2020-10-02 14:42:42 -07:00
Mouse Reeve 9bc6d7d6b6
Merge pull request #214 from mouse-reeve/user-permissions
Adds user permissions and groups
2020-10-02 13:55:59 -07:00
Mouse Reeve d4b18678bd Forgot password flow 2020-10-02 13:32:19 -07:00
Mouse Reeve f8f4d09ede
Merge pull request #215 from mouse-reeve/logo
Adds better logo
2020-10-01 13:55:48 -07:00
Mouse Reeve 36f7ab36c9 Adds better logo 2020-10-01 13:53:52 -07:00
Mouse Reeve 7138cd4811
Merge pull request #213 from mouse-reeve/invite-only
Invite only
2020-10-01 13:46:54 -07:00
Mouse Reeve c396489dff Adds permissions to templates 2020-10-01 13:09:37 -07:00
Mouse Reeve 9209039761 Permission decorators for views 2020-10-01 12:59:38 -07:00
Mouse Reeve d78c271107 Adds required permissions and groups 2020-10-01 12:48:55 -07:00
Mouse Reeve ab21d2051a Fixes celery image storage
Fixes #207
2020-10-01 10:20:40 -07:00
Mouse Reeve 6b5246f06a
Merge pull request #209 from mouse-reeve/connector-errors
Raise errors when connectors fail
2020-10-01 08:29:39 -07:00
Mouse Reeve 33fe00f190
Merge pull request #212 from mouse-reeve/covers-bug
Fixes celery media path
2020-10-01 08:29:25 -07:00
Mouse Reeve 2fd192d6cc Updates ui and redirects for invites 2020-09-30 20:47:26 -07:00
Mouse Reeve 9e2ab147fb Hide registration form when registration is closed 2020-09-30 20:31:44 -07:00
Mouse Reeve 94d5986ff2 More error handling in connector/books manager 2020-09-30 20:09:25 -07:00
Mouse Reeve fe83f5d442 small style fixes and typo 2020-09-30 19:57:25 -07:00
Mouse Reeve 0b8f8e3659 Fixes celery media path 2020-09-30 19:43:42 -07:00
Mouse Reeve 4fda5c8e22
Merge pull request #206 from mouse-reeve/ui-overhaul
Ui overhaul
2020-09-30 17:15:22 -07:00
Mouse Reeve 58d617e438 Removed unused views code 2020-09-30 17:14:05 -07:00
Mouse Reeve c3092c4979 Removes discover books page 2020-09-30 16:30:50 -07:00
Mouse Reeve 6e1c116329 Author page 2020-09-30 16:20:50 -07:00
Mouse Reeve 7582540fe9 Remove test print statement 2020-09-30 16:02:27 -07:00
Mouse Reeve 0ab07c41ef Separate ratings out from reviews on book page 2020-09-30 16:00:41 -07:00
Mouse Reeve 5c7f44dc2d Fixes bug in create status forms 2020-09-30 15:24:44 -07:00
Mouse Reeve f22d773cc4 Removes unused view logic for books page 2020-09-30 15:18:44 -07:00
Mouse Reeve 982f734ce7 Use bulma screen-reader-only class 2020-09-30 15:10:37 -07:00
Mouse Reeve ada6a79b1c Error and 404 pages 2020-09-30 15:04:57 -07:00
Mouse Reeve 9994bdc81e select suggested books for statuses 2020-09-30 15:00:46 -07:00
Mouse Reeve f196787c16 More books in suggestions
and show the shelve button
2020-09-30 12:19:23 -07:00
Mouse Reeve f6d754f0c4 styles for import status page 2020-09-30 12:11:53 -07:00
Mouse Reeve 92ef3a574c Fix notification count styling 2020-09-30 12:02:00 -07:00
Mouse Reeve ada09639b7 Remove unnecessary icon-related css 2020-09-30 12:01:17 -07:00
Mouse Reeve 7612bcf096 Use "tag" for notifications 2020-09-30 11:56:02 -07:00
Mouse Reeve 49807d069f format multiple book references in a status 2020-09-30 11:49:41 -07:00
Mouse Reeve 3e65d53305 Remove unused templatetags 2020-09-30 11:47:52 -07:00
Mouse Reeve 2b710c44e4 Handle user search 404s 2020-09-30 11:33:15 -07:00
Mouse Reeve 8dba4ccf47 Error hanlding for user search 2020-09-30 11:23:23 -07:00
Mouse Reeve f72d59955e Raise errors when connectors fail 2020-09-30 10:37:29 -07:00
Mouse Reeve 9efe1a3990 Small ui fixes 2020-09-30 09:00:33 -07:00
Mouse Reeve e7368b8228
Merge pull request #203 from mouse-reeve/emailing
Adds email config
2020-09-29 22:03:01 -07:00